<br />. Number of inflow points into the South Platte River: 55 (includes rivers, creeks, main <br />distribution and bifurcation canals, reservoir spill canals, city return flows) <br /> <br />. Number of water rights: 167 <br /> <br />. Number of augmentation plans (well, group of wells, surface reservoir): 12 <br /> <br />. Topography <br /> <br />. Aquifer parameters <br /> <br />. Hydraulic properties of the stream <br /> <br />. Seepage characteristics of the canals and reservoirs <br /> <br />. Canal configuration <br /> <br />. Configuration of the stream-aquifer system <br /> <br />. Supply irrigated area configuration <br /> <br />. List of Crops: Small grains, Winter wheat, Sorghum, Alfalfa (P-lst Cut), Alfalfa (NP-l st <br />Cut), Alfalfa (2nd Cut), Alfalfa (3rd Cut), Com, Sugar beets, Beans, Potatoes, Onions <br /> <br />. Soil characteristics of the root zone <br /> <br />. Reservoir system configuration <br /> <br />. Reservoir storages (11): Barr Lake, Pond, Milton, Lower Latham, Empire, Riverside, <br />Bijou #2, Jackson Lake, Prewitt, Sterling, and Julesburg. <br /> <br />. Ponds (7): Bijou, Fort Morgan, Pioneer Terminate Ditch, Lower Platte-Beaver, Hassle- <br />Davis Bros., Home ranch ofWYM BRAVO, Condon Harmony ditch. <br /> <br />. Non-supply area configuration <br /> <br />. Recharge information <br /> <br />. Daily precipitation <br /> <br />. Climatological stations (14): Denver(52220), Longmont (55116), Fort Lupton (53027), <br />Greeley (53553), Briggsdale (50945), Wiggins (59025), New Raymer (55922), Fort <br />Morgan (53038), Sterling (57950), Leroy (54945), Fleming (52944), Sedgwick (57515), <br />Julesburg (54413). <br /> <br />daily temperature <br /> <br />- wind velocity <br /> <br />- humidity <br /> <br />daily discharge river flow <br /> <br />. River gaging stations (6): Denver (06714000), Henderson (06720500), Kersey <br />(06754000), Weldona (06758500), Balzac (0676000), Julesburg (0676400). <br /> <br />.
